Military Working Dogs At the January meeting Sandy Bailey presented her efforts to help Ralph Orlando with Military Working Dogs and my journey with legislation. Below is a way that you might be able to help. Congressman Ron DeSantis has proposed legislation to help veterans with PTSD acquire a service dog - Puppies Assisting Wounded Service members (PAWS) Act. Under the bill the Veterans Administration would pay third-party dog training organizations for the dogs they provide to veterans in the program. The bill would authorize $27,000 for the VA to spend on each dog from an organization accredited by Assistance Dog International. It also includes VA health insurance for the dog. In total the PAWS Act allocates $10 million to fund the pilot program. The bill is also requiring the VA to provide veterinary care for the dog, that is a huge benefit to the soldier. So far Congressman DeSantis has over 140 members on board for this, but we need more. While it great to call DeSantis and share your support for this bill, we need everyone to call their friends and family out of our district and encourage those Congressman to get on board and support this bill.
